B.C. man completes seven-week term guarding the Tomb Of The Unknown Soldier

Master Corporal Steve Pederson has been a Canadian Ranger for 31 years.

The past seven weeks have been among the most memorable for the Courtenay resident.

Pederson just returned from a tour of duty guarding the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ier, at the National War Memorial in Confederation Square, in Ottawa.

香蕉视频直播淚t was a huge honour just to be selected,香蕉视频直播 said Pederson. 香蕉视频直播淭he call went out for interested persons to apply. We put our name in and I was selected from my group, which is the 4th Canadian Ranger Patrol Group, which covers the four western provinces. There were six of us selected from that, to participate with 12 members of the Canadian Armed Forces to make up Roto 6 - the time period from Sept. 8-Oct.22.香蕉视频直播

This is the 75th anniversary of the Canadian Rangers. As such, every roto at the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ier in 2022 has had at least one Canadian Ranger involved.

香蕉视频直播淚 was pleasantly surprised when I was selected. We arrived in Ottawa Sept. 8香蕉视频直播 and proceeded to do a week of fairly intensive drills and marching, to make sure we were up to step. For our duty, we worked a four-day on, four-day off schedule. We were marched up with a piper to take our post.香蕉视频直播

Pederson is still in awe of his experience.

香蕉视频直播淚 don香蕉视频直播檛 even know how to describe it,香蕉视频直播 he said. 香蕉视频直播淚t was just a tremendous opportunity to represent my unit, and the Canadian Forces in general.香蕉视频直播

The Tomb of the Unknown Soldier is Canada香蕉视频直播檚 most iconic and visible reminder of the service and sacrifice of the Canadian Armed Forces members.

The Tomb of the Unknown Soldier honours the more than 116,000 Canadians who sacrificed their lives in the cause of peace and freedom.

The Unknown Soldier represents all serving Canadians 香蕉视频直播 Navy, Army, Air Force, or Merchant Marine. Those who died or may die for their country in all conflicts 香蕉视频直播 past, present, and future.

While the sentry duty is largely ceremonial, there is an official responsibility to it as well.

香蕉视频直播淚f somebody disrespects the tomb, we are to come to attention, step forward香蕉视频直播 and in a very firm voice, ask them to step back. if they don香蕉视频直播檛, we are overwatched by military police officers, who will intervene,香蕉视频直播 said Pederson.

He said other than a few children who encroached upon the tomb without an understanding of the area, there were no incidents during his time at the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ier.

Pederson香蕉视频直播檚 duty ended on the eighth anniversary of the death of Cpl. Nathan Cirillo, who was gunned down was standing guard on ceremonial sentry duty at the Canadian National War Memorial.

Pederson香蕉视频直播檚 Ranger responsibility is the western part of Vancouver Island - the Zebellos area.

香蕉视频直播淲e are basically the eyes and the ears for the Armed Forces,香蕉视频直播 said Pederson. 香蕉视频直播淲e serve in remote and isolated communities across the country. If we see anything out of the ordinary, we pass the information along.香蕉视频直播

Pederson is a well-decorated Ranger. He has a special service medal, a Queen香蕉视频直播檚 Diamond Jubilee Medal, and has been a two-time recipient of the Canadian Decoration Ranger bar.
